Summary of Nahum Chapter 2

Something has come that divides and scatters the people[1] which was seen in the story of Nimrod and Babylon. We are warned to watch the way and strengthen our loins.[2] This is done by living by the ways of love, charity, and hope., not force, fear, and fealty under Assyrian contracts which mars and empties[3] the vine of fruit.

They cast their wealth away and the lion's heart disappeared from their society. And God will not hear them because they will not hear the cries of one another so that the "the sword shall devour thy young lions".

Without Repentance and a return to a daily ministration of Pure Religion through charity and the perfect law of liberty the people will be devoured and ruined.
